The consumer protection authority tested baby chairs, diaper tables and diapers
The Hungarian National Consumer Protection Authority (NCPA) tested baby chairs, diaper tables and diapers.
Two out of five baby chairs and one out of ten diaper tables did not meet the safety requirements. The authority withdrew these products from the market.
The full list of tested products can be found on the authority's website. (MTI)
